First statement from the founder of Binance who came out of prison: Will he return to crypto?

Binance's founder and former CEO Changpeng Zhao, who was released from prison on Friday, gave the message that he would return to crypto, stressing that he will continue to invest in blockchain and decentralized technologies. Stating that he will devote more time and resources to charity work and education, Zhao said, "See you at the conferences!" Said.

Changpeng Zhao, the CEO of Binance, the world's largest cryptocurrency exchange, made his first statement after serving a four-month prison sentence and being released.

In a statement on his personal X account, Zhao stated that he will continue to invest in areas such as blockchain and decentralized technologies, artificial intelligence and biotechnology. Zhao also stated that things are also going well without himself at the wheel at Binance.
